Comedic couple take the stage after devastating house fire

Despite the couple's Durban North home being gutted in a fire less than two weeks ago, the show still went on last night.

COMEDIC actors, Aaron McIlroy and Lisa Bobbert are back on the stage after a devastating fire destroyed their Durban North home on 6 July.

Durban theatre goers turned out in droves for MacBob’s acclaimed musical comedy, Bloopers which kicked off its Elizabeth Sneddon season last night before a packed house.

Audiences enjoyed every moment as the duo perform one of their all-time funniest shows.

These multi-award winning legends boldly go where no intelligent person should, tackling subjects such as cultural appropriation, landfills, land grabs, hand grabs, cannabis oil and the ridiculous things humans get up to – all with a rocking musical back beat.
